Its a great shame to see such an iconic brand in such a mess. You only have to go to what's left of shops on the high street to see confirmation that the shelf space which was once Hornby's firm territory is steadily being taken over by its competition due to the supply issue. This seems to have been with us for over a year now that I know of, which started for me trying to get the R8247 accessory decoders for example. This turned out to be the tip of the iceberg. Even basic things like Hornby Track are getting harder to source these days.

 

 

The bad decisions / miscalculations they have made on this website / forum in isolation are not enough for me to turn my back on the Hornby brand, HOWEVER, when taking EVERYTHING into consideration, that day is coming closer after over 45 years. (Blimey, that makes me feel old!!)

 

 

The upsetting aspect to all this is that we must be coming towards a "will the last one out, switch the lights off" moment ? .........................................
